About Newark, DE

Newark is known for its abundance of green space, from urban parks to lush forested trails. The lively college town is anchored by the University of Delaware, a historic campus known for its ivy-covered buildings and fascinating museums.

Things to do in Newark

Rittenhouse Park is Newark's signature green space. A trout-filled creek runs through the heart of the park, which makes it popular with anglers, picnickers and dog walkers. You can also stretch your legs at White Clay Creek State Park, a national forest laced with scenic hiking trails. The loop trail around Newark Reservoir is a hotspot for local cyclists.

From rare gemstones to African American art, the University of Delaware is home to a handful of niche museums. Don't miss the Mineralogical Museum in Penny Hall, which is filled with a treasure trove of natural crystals, meteorites and rock carvings.

Delaware is famous for its duty-free shopping, and there's no better place to indulge in a little retail therapy than Christiana Mall. Located just out of town, the sprawling shopping centre features over 130 specialty stores, a bustling food court and 17-screen movie theatre.

Newark is anchored by a lively downtown core where you'll find shops, cafes and restaurants. Most of the action is centred along Main Street, a bustling strip lined with historic buildings. You’ll find a mix of retro diners, student-friendly coffee shops, pint-sized antique emporiums and grassroots craft stores.

Getting around Newark

Downtown Newark is easy to get around on foot. Rental cars are also a flexible way to explore Newark and the New Castle County region. The city is well-serviced by a network of local buses, as well as rideshare services like Uber.
